Solution for -24+p=-4(p+1) equation:



-24+p=-4(p+1)
We move all terms to the left:
-24+p-(-4(p+1))=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(-4(p+1)), so:
-4(p+1)
We multiply parentheses
-4p-4
Back to the equation:
-(-4p-4)
We get rid of parentheses
p+4p+4-24=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
5p-20=0
We move all terms containing p to the left, all other terms to the right
5p=20
p=20/5
p=4
